Pull x86 mm updates from Dave Hansen:
 "There are some small things here, plus one big one.

  The big one detected and refused to create W+X kernel mappings. This
  caused a bit of trouble and it is entirely disabled on 32-bit due to
  known unfixable EFI issues. It also oopsed on some systemd eBPF use,
  which kept some users from booting.

  The eBPF issue is fixed, but those troubles were caught relatively
  recently which made me nervous that there are more lurking. The final
  commit in here retains the warnings, but doesn't actually refuse to
  create W+X mappings.

  Summary:

   - Detect insecure W+X mappings and warn about them, including a few
     bug fixes and relaxing the enforcement

   - Do a long-overdue defconfig update and enabling W+X boot-time
     detection

   - Cleanup _PAGE_PSE handling (follow-up on an earlier bug)

   - Rename a change_page_attr function"

/*
* Validate strict W^X semantics.
*/
static inline pgprot_t verify_rwx(pgprot_t old, pgprot_t new, unsigned long start,
unsigned long pfn, unsigned long npg)
{
unsigned long end;

/*
* 32-bit has some unfixable W+X issues, like EFI code
* and writeable data being in the same page. Disable
* detection and enforcement there.
*/
if (IS_ENABLED(CONFIG_X86_32))
return new;

/* Only verify when NX is supported: */
if (!(__supported_pte_mask & _PAGE_NX))
return new;

if (!((pgprot_val(old) ^ pgprot_val(new)) & (_PAGE_RW | _PAGE_NX)))
return new;

if ((pgprot_val(new) & (_PAGE_RW | _PAGE_NX)) != _PAGE_RW)
return new;

end = start + npg * PAGE_SIZE - 1;
WARN_ONCE(1, "CPA detected W^X violation: %016llx -> %016llx range: 0x%016lx - 0x%016lx PFN %lx\n",
(unsigned long long)pgprot_val(old),
(unsigned long long)pgprot_val(new),
start, end, pfn);

/*
* For now, allow all permission change attempts by returning the
* attempted permissions. This can 'return old' to actively
* refuse the permission change at a later time.
*/
return new;
}
